Library computerization refers to the integration of computer technology into library operations, including cataloging, circulation, and information retrieval. This process enhances efficiency, improves access to resources, and streamlines administrative tasks, allowing librarians to focus more on user services and support. By digitizing collections and utilizing databases, libraries can offer patrons improved search capabilities and access to a wider range of materials, ultimately fostering a more engaging and informative environment. Additionally, computerization facilitates better data management and reporting, which can inform future collection development and library services.
